An Argentine goalkeeper scored a goal from goal to goal rarely seen to sink Colo Colo

2023-03-19T12:02:13.323Z


It is Leandro Requena, from Cobresal, who scored the third in the 3-1 win over El Cacique. It had not happened in Chilean soccer since 1990.


Things for

Colo Colo

were not going well.

The match had 13 minutes left and he could not find a return to

Cobresal

, who was winning 2-0. And things got worse in the least expected way: the Argentine goalkeeper

Leandro Requena

hit a left-footed shot to take the goal kick and ended up celebrating the third because the ball ended up in the other arc.

What happened?

Colo Colo played very advanced, among them the goalkeeper Brayan Cortés who was several meters outside the area.

Requena's sending was left over, the Chilean was halfway between the setback and the intention of heading it and the ball continued its course until it touched the net.

Was it worth?

Yes,

it is contemplated in rule 16

:

"A goal may be scored directly from a goal kick, but only against the opposing team; if the ball enters the kicker's goal directly, the opponent will be awarded a corner kick"

Requena played in several teams of the Argentine promotion and recently passed through Central Córdoba in Santiago del Estero he was the center of attention and of the uncontrolled celebrations of his teammates.

It was victory for Cobresal

, although Colo Colo had time to discount.

With the result, the team that added the three points remains in the qualifying zone for the next South American, while remaining in the middle of the standings.

According to data from the Association of Chilean Football Researchers and Investigators, the last goal from goal in the national league was in 1990, when Osmar Brunelli from Club Atlético Fernández Vial scored a similar goal against Santiago Wanderers.


Who is Requena?

Requena's career is based mainly on the rise of Argentine soccer.

He cut short in Talleres de Córdoba in his time in the National B and Federal A;

Sportivo Patria, Athens of San Carlos (Uruguay);

Deportivo Santamarina;

North Transept;

Ferro;

New Chicago and the Andes.

In First Division, in 2019 in Central Córdoba and currently in Cobresal, in Chile.

The goal against Colo Colo was the first of his career, with more than 200 games, between which he stood under the three sticks or was an alternative on the substitute bench.
